What is DEMA? The Diving Equipment and Marketing Association is a non-profit trade association. Monies raised through the industryâ€&#x;s participation in the annual DEMA Trade Show, sponsorships, and through DEMA Memberships, funds all of the activities of the association. Unlike for-profit show organizers which funnel the money earned at shows AWAY from the diving industry, DEMA funnels everything back to DEMA promotions, market and industry research, operations, disaster assistance, and other industry efforts, all for the benefit of DEMA Members. Like most trade associations, DEMA has several functions within the recreational diving industry. DEMA is involved with promoting recreational scuba diving and snorkeling through PR activities and advertising, delivering educational programming for members and consumers, lobbying on behalf of the diving industry, and other functions. DEMA is a (501 [c] 6) California Corporation. Description: Worldwide Trade Association for the Recreational Diving and Snorkeling Industries; Includes more than 1,400 member companies worldwide. Mission: To Promote sustainable growth in recreational diving and snorkeling while protecting the environment. Goals: 1. To produce an annual trade event for the industry that services the needs of its stakeholders and produces a successful financial outcome for the association. 2. To engage in marketing programs which promote the industry, create new customers, drive business into retail stores and resorts and promote diver retention. 3. To monitor potential legislation that could adversely affect the industry. 4. To engage in marketing research programs which will: a. Define the universe of divers b. Determine the rate of erosion amongst existing divers c. Determine the number of entry level certifications which take place in the United States and Caribbean each year d. Provide retail audit information that is made self-liquidating through annual subscriptions. 5. To protect natural aquatic resources.
